Strong's H6023 (Hebrew)

Hebrew: עֲמַשְׁסַי (ʻĂmashçay)

Pronunciation: am-ash-sah'-ee

Morphology: n-pr-m

Name Meaning: Amashai = "burdensome"

Derivation: probably from עָמַס (ʻâmaç) H6006; burdensome

Definition: Amashsay, an Israelite

KJV Renderings: Amashai

Senses

  1. a priest, son of Azareel in the time of Nehemiah
